The short answer
Arlington Classics Academy ranks #107 of 899 Texas districts by overall school rating. Arlington Classics Academy's schools with real test data average 8.1/10 across 3 schools. Its top-rated schools are Arlington Classics Academy - Arkansas Campus (9.2/10), Arlington Classics Academy -intermediate (7.7/10), and Arlington Classics Academy - Middle (7.3/10). Schools with estimated (proxy) scores are excluded from this ranking.
STAAR proficiency rose +6.3 points from 2022 to 2024. That's the biggest jump among Arlington Classics Academy schools across the two most recent comparable testing years.

About Arlington Classics Academy
Arlington Classics Academy is a Arlington, Texas school district serving 3 schools. The district educates 1,494 students with a student-teacher ratio of 15.7:1. The district invests $9,829 per student annually.
With an average rating of 8.1/10, Arlington Classics Academy is among the strongest-performing districts in the state.
The highest-rated school in the district is Arlington Classics Academy - Arkansas Campus, which has a composite score of 9.2/10.
In standardized testing, Arlington Classics Academy students show an average math proficiency of 73.9% and ELA proficiency of 80.9%.
The district includes 2 elementary schools , 1 middle school .
